ImocaGen: A Model-based Code Generator for Embedded Systems Tuning

Goulven Guillou, Jean-Philippe Babau

2016

Abstract

IMOCA is a model-based architecture model dedicated to embedded process control systems in disturbed environment. These systems depend on various parameters which are difficult to set because they are bound to environment changes. In this paper we propose to extend IMOCA with the meta-model ImocaGen for managing the aspects of the code generation. ImocaGen allows to target multiple platforms and different programming languages, generates both embedded code as well as tuning and reconfiguration tools, takes into account different communication protocols and offers a mechanism for integrating handwritten code. This approach is tested on a basic control application for a NXT brick for which three generations are performed: the first one for a PC with an USB connection, the second one for an Android tablet with a Bluetooth connection and the last one for a simulator in Java.
